Understanding Dental Implants

Dental implants are artificial tooth roots that provide a permanent base for fixed, replacement teeth. They are designed to blend seamlessly with your natural teeth, offering a durable and functional solution for missing teeth.

How Do Dental Implants Work?

The dental implant process involves several steps:

  • Consultation: Your journey begins with a thorough consultation where your dentist will evaluate your oral health and determine the best approach for your needs.
  • Implant Placement: A titanium post is surgically inserted into your jawbone, acting as the root of the replacement tooth.
  • Healing Process: Over several months, the implant fuses with the bone in a process called osseointegration.
  • Abutment Placement: After healing, an abutment is placed on the implant to hold the replacement tooth.
  • Crown Placement: Finally, a custom crown is placed on top of the abutment, completing the restoration.

The Cost of Dental Implants in Turkey

The cost of dental implants in Turkey varies depending on several factors:

  • Type of Implant: Different materials (like titanium vs. zirconium) can affect the overall cost.
  • Number of Implants: The more implants you need, the higher the total cost.
  • Clinic Reputation: Well-established clinics with high patient satisfaction might charge more.
  • Additional Treatments: If you require bone grafts or sinus lifts, expect additional costs.

Average Cost Breakdown

On average, the cost of a single dental implant in Turkey ranges from $300 to $1000, while in the US, the same procedure can cost between $3,000 and $4,500. Here’s a quick breakdown of typical costs you might encounter:

  • Dental Implant Fixture: $300 - $800
  • Abutment Cost: $100 - $300
  • Crown Cost: $150 - $500
  • Total for one implant: Approximately $600 - $1600

What to Expect During Your Dental Implant Journey

Understanding the process can alleviate concerns. Here’s a general timeline:

Initial Consultation

During your first visit, the dentist will assess your dental health and discuss your concerns. They may take X-rays or scans to develop a personal treatment plan.

Implant Placement Surgery

This is typically done under local anesthesia. The procedure may take 1-2 hours for a single implant. You might experience mild discomfort, but pain management solutions are available.

Healing and Follow-Up Visits

The healing process takes several months, during which follow-up visits will ensure proper integration of the implant. After healing, you’ll return for the abutment and crown placement.

Potential Risks and Considerations

As with any medical procedure, there are potential risks involved with dental implants:

  • Infection: at the implant site.
  • Nerve Damage: which can lead to numbness or pain.
  • Failure to Integrate: where the implant doesn't properly fuse with the jawbone.

However, the success rate for dental implants is over 95%, especially when done by a qualified professional.

Post-Operative Care

Caring for your dental implants is crucial to ensuring their longevity. Here are some tips:

  • Maintain good oral hygiene with regular brushing and flossing.
  • Schedule regular check-ups with your dentist.
  • Avoid hard foods that may damage the implant.
  • Quit smoking, as it can hinder healing and increase the risk of implant failure.
